1. NATURE AND CONTINUANCE OF OPERATIONS
Pacific Therapeutics Ltd. ("the Company" or "PTL") was incorporated under the laws of the Province of British Columbia, Canada on September 12, 2005. The Company is a development stage company focused on developing proprietary drugs to treat certain types of lung disease including fibrosis. On October 14, 2011, the Company became a reporting company in British Columbia and was approved by the Canadian National Stock exchange (“CNSX”) and opened for trading on November 16, 2011.
PTL has financed its cash requirements primarily from share issuances and payments from research collaborators. The Company's ability to realize the carrying value of its assets is dependent on successfully bringing its technologies to market and achieving future profitable operations, the outcome of which cannot be predicted at this time. It will be necessary for the Company to raise additional funds for the continuing development of its technologies.
The financial statements have been prepared on a going concern basis, which contemplates continuity of operations and the realization of assets and settlement of liabilities in the ordinary course of business. The Company is subject to risks and uncertainties common to drug discovery companies, including technological change, potential infringement on intellectual property of and by third parties, new product development, regulatory approval and market acceptance of its products, activities of competitors and its limited operating history. All of these factors create uncertainty in the Company's ability to successfully bring its technologies to market, to achieve future profitable operations and to realize the carrying value of its assets. Given these uncertainties, there is significant doubt as to the Company’s ability to continue as a going concern. The accompanying financial statements do not include any adjustments that might result from the outcome of these uncertainties.

6. CONVERTIBLE NOTES
On September 24, 2012 the Company issued a convertible note (“the Note”) with a face value of $30,000 plus 200,000 two year $0.22 warrants (Bonus Warrants) for $30,000 in cash. The Note has a term of one year and is repayable by the Issuer at any time. The holder of the Note may convert the whole note or any portion into units at any time. Each unit will consist of 1 common share (the Share Option) and 1 warrant (the warrant option), with each warrant option exercisable to acquire an additional common share for a period of 2 years from the date the warrant was issued. Subject to regulatory approval the conversion price per unit will be at a 25% discount to the ten day weighted average price of the issuer’s shares at the date of conversion. Subject to regulatory approval the exercise price per warrant option will be at a 25% premium to the ten day weighted average price of the issuer’s shares at the date of conversion. Each bonus warrant is exercisable to acquire an additional common share for a period of two years from the closing date at a price of $0.22. The Note accrues interest at the rate of 1% per month, payable in quarterly installments.
The estimated fair value of the share options was calculated on the grant date as $18,232.
Upon initial recognition, the Company bifurcated the $30,000 proceeds between the component parts of the convertible note using the relative fair value method with $12,317 allocated to convertible loan, $12,248 to share and warrant option (derivative liability) and $5,435 to warrant reserve.
The discount on the component parts of the convertible note are accredited as interest expense over the one year term of the note. As at June 30, 2013 the derivative liability was re-measured to fair value. This resulted in a loss on derivative liability being recognized on the face of the financial statements of $13,255 (December 31, 2012 - $18,641).

9. FINANCIAL INSTRUMENTS AND RISK
As at June 30, 2013, the Company’s financial instruments consist of cash and cash equivalents, accounts payable and accrued liabilities, shareholder demand loan, a convertible note and a derivative liability. The convertible note has been bifurcated and presented in the financial statements using its component parts.
The fair value of cash and cash equivalents, accounts payable and accrued liabilities and shareholder demand loans approximate their carrying values because of the short term nature of these instruments. These are classified as level 1 in the fair value hierarchy.
The derivative liability is measured at fair value at the end of each reporting period. Because revaluation at fair value includes the use of valuation techniques, the derivative liability is classified as level 3 in the fair value hierarchy.
Credit Risk
Financial instruments that potentially subject the Company to concentrations of credit risks consist principally of cash and cash equivalents. To minimize the credit risk the Company places these instruments with a high credit quality financial institution.
Liquidity Risk
The Company ensures its holding of cash and cash equivalents is sufficient to meet its short-term general and administrative expenditures. All of the Company’s financial liabilities are subject to normal trade terms. The Company does not have investments in any asset-backed deposits.
